Vehicle Diagnostic Explained: Exploring Vehicle Health Checks

Vehicle diagnostics is a computerized evaluation method that examines your vehicle’s onboard computers and components to identify existing or developing issues before they turn into major problems. The Function of Automotive Diagnostics

At the center of vehicle diagnostics is the Onboard Diagnostics (OBD) system present in most current vehicles. This system continuously observes various systems and subsystems through a system of sensors measuring multiple parameters including engine RPM, oxygen levels, temperature, and more. When something isn’t functioning properly, these computer systems store errors in the form of specific diagnostic trouble codes (DTCs).

The method typically involves these steps:

A automotive professional attaches a dedicated diagnostic scanner to the vehicle’s OBD port (usually positioned under the dashboard on the driver’s side)

The scanner communicates with the vehicle’s computer systems to retrieve any recorded trouble codes

These codes identify specific areas or elements that may be not working properly

Using these codes as a guide, mechanics can narrow their investigation and investigate the source of the issue

Modern vehicles contain extensive computer networks that supply specific information on key systems. When dashboard alerts illuminate on your dashboard, they indicate that the onboard computer has found an anomaly somewhere in the vehicle.

Areas Checked During Analysis

Car diagnostic tests can analyze several essential aspects of your vehicle including:

Engine system: Assessing fuel supply, air filters, and analyzing readings from sensors within the combustion system

Transmission: Assessing performance and finding potential issues

Brake responsiveness: Examining for abnormal wear in brake pads and checking brake lines for damage

Exhaust system: Analyzing emissions and identifying leaks or blockages

Electrical systems: Checking the battery, starter motor, alternator, and power steering pumps

Fuel injection system: Verifying proper fuel delivery

Ignition coils: Confirming proper spark delivery

Throttle: Verifying proper operation

These comprehensive checks provide a detailed evaluation of your vehicle’s overall health and performance.

Technology Behind Diagnostics

Several types of diagnostic tools are utilized depending on the difficulty of the issue:

OBD-II scanners: These portable devices connect to the OBD port and extract diagnostic trouble codes. Basic models simply display the codes, while more advanced versions interpret them and propose potential solutions.

Diagnostic software: More comprehensive computer programs that provide thorough analysis and complete reports on vehicle health.

Specialized systems: Professional repair shops often use proprietary diagnostic tools that allow deeper access to vehicle systems and more specific information.

Situations Requiring Vehicle Diagnostics

Auto diagnostics should be scheduled:

When warning lights appear on your dashboard (especially the check engine light)

During routine maintenance to discover potential issues early

When you detect changes in vehicle performance, unusual noises, or reduced fuel efficiency

Before purchasing a used vehicle to check for hidden problems

Post repairs to ensure the issues have been completely resolved

Auto diagnostics have transformed vehicle maintenance from a reactive process to a preventative one. By using the sophisticated computer systems in modern vehicles, these tests enable owners and technicians to discover and resolve issues before they lead to malfunctions or expensive repairs, making sure your vehicle remains dependable, fuel-saving, and protected on the road.
